Full story

A developer has introduced MCP cacheScope, a new feature designed to prevent private AI model responses from being inadvertently shared across users through cached data. The issue arises when a response is fresh but still unsafe for another user, creating a subtle but critical security vulnerability in systems relying on Model Context Protocol (MCP) caching mechanisms.

The cacheScope mechanism works by enforcing strict isolation rules for cached responses, ensuring that sensitive or user-specific data cannot be reused or exposed to unintended users. This addresses a previously overlooked gap in AI model caching systems, where performance optimizations could inadvertently compromise privacy.

The solution is particularly relevant for organizations deploying AI models in multi-tenant environments, where user data separation is paramount. By implementing cacheScope, developers can mitigate risks of data leaks while maintaining the performance benefits of caching.

Glossary
MCP
Model Context Protocol, a framework for managing AI model interactions and caching.
Multi-tenant environment
A system architecture where multiple users or organizations share the same infrastructure while keeping their data separate.
